Michael Gove faces scrutiny over school sexual abuse scandal

By Dr. Izzadeen Chowdhury 4 Raj 39 ◦︎ 21 Mar 18

Michael Gove, former Secretary of State for Education and now Environment Secretary, has become embroiled in an enquiry into whether he intervened into the investigation of a Priest who is alleged to have committed child sex offences at a Catholic school.[1]

Two witnesses to the Independent Investigation into Child Sexual Abuse have given evidence confirming that they were approached by someone at the education department, at the time that Mr Gove was Secretary of State, who inappropriately insisted on being provided with confidential information relating to the outcome of the investigation.

The priest in question taught at Downside School.  The school is known to have links with arch-Brexiteer Jacob Rees-Mogg as his mother was formerly charged with a child protection role at the school including during the investigation.  Mr Rees-Mogg has not yet responded formally to questions about whether Mr Gove’s intervention, which he denies, was at his behest.
